Transaction ec1e636bc3deebb18135e8a8a343079452951a3360c356f9b9d32153525b0508
1 Input
1 Output
-
ec1e636bc3deebb18135e8a8a343079452951a3360c356f9b9d32153525b0508:0
- value
- 30423
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2c05060c6a9829bc6f6a6077a88b0145b31b54c2 OP_EQUAL
- address
- 35hmg2owha5BaLzsPi25pdfpzsXyniYEvE